Brunei - Export of Cans of Iron or Steel of a Capacity Not Exceeding 50L
Since 2014, Brunei Export of Cans of Iron or Steel of a Capacity Not Exceeding 50L fell by 52% year on year. With $1,416.14 in 2019, the country was ranked number 102 among other countries in Export of Cans of Iron or Steel of a Capacity Not Exceeding 50L. Brunei is overtaken by Zambia, which was ranked number 101 at $1,565 and is followed by Burkina Faso at $1,374.58. China lead the ranking with $520,620,659.39 in 2019, that is a decrease of 0.2% versus 2018. Spain, United States and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bahamas recorded the best 5 years average growth at +482.8% per year, while Tanzania recorded the worst performance at -92.6% per year.
